first off what I would recommend is that you adjust to the training routine of the 10k programs and once you have run through a few cycles we can then start to adapt the program to achieve your specific goals
what we need to know now if what type of shape you are in now and then from there we can start constructing your sessions and then work towards adding hills etc
so a 4k time-trial is our call for now
provide as much info about the test as possible
if you can do this on a 400m track all the better then we can have your lap splits and if you have a heart rate monitor then even better
